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Windermere to Blythe Bridge start from as little as £10.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Windermere to Blythe Bridge start from £55.30 one way, or £79.00 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Windermere to Blythe Bridge are available for £60.50 one way, or £121.00 return

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Facilities and Amenities at Windermere Station

Windermere Station offers a range of amenities to make your travel as easy and comfortable as possible. The station's ticket office is open Monday from 06:40 to 20:45, and Sunday from 11:10 to 20:40, ensuring you have time to plan your journey or purchase tickets. For your convenience, ticket machines are also available for collecting tickets bought online, and they are accessible to all passengers, including those with disabilities.

For assistance, staff are present during the ticket office's open hours, and help points are available for customer inquiries. Passenger Assist is on hand for travelers requiring additional support, and step-free access is a welcome feature throughout the station. Although there are no waiting rooms, there’s ample seating provided for your comfort. Toilets, including accessible facilities and baby changing areas, are also available during ticket office hours.

Facilities and Services

Despite being a smaller station, Blythe Bridge is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a comfortable experience for its passengers. While there might not be a ticket office, ticket machines are readily available for all your travel needs. It’s important to note that these machines are not accessible to those with certain disabilities, and the collection of tickets bought online isn’t facilitated here. You'll find smartcard validators here but not smartcards themselves. Although the platform offers step-free access, travelers with mobility challenges should be mindful of the uneven surfaces at the level crossing.

For those in need of assistance, there’s always on-hand support available through the help points, although staffed assistance isn't provided around the clock. Furthermore, if lost property is a concern, the East Midlands Railway lost property office in Nottingham handles such cases, keeping items for up to three months.

Though amenities such as refreshment facilities, waiting rooms, and public Wi-Fi are absent, the station accommodates cyclists with bicycle storage spaces. There’s also CCTV coverage to help ensure a level of security for both personal belongings and travelers.
